AT&T's Samsung Galaxy S2 gets its Android 4.0 update tomorrow

Starting tomorrow, the Samsung Galaxy S III won't be the only member of its family to use Google's Android 4.0 operating system on AT&T. The network will begin to roll out Ice Cream Sandwich updates to the Samsung Galaxy S II as well.

Unfortunately for AT&T customers, making the leap from Gingerbread to ICS will take a little more legwork than a simple over-the-air bump. You'll have to first visit Samsung's Web site from your computer, then download the Samsung Kies Upgrade Program to your desktop or laptop.

Android 4.0.4 update reaches Sony's Xperia S

Sony is rolling out the latest flavor of Android 4.0 to its Xperia S customers starting today.

Users can update their phones over the air via a mobile network or WiFi, or sync their phones with their PCs using Sony's Xperia Update Web site, PC Companion, or Bridge for Mac software.

The update weighs in at around 200MB, so using Wi-Fi directly or syncing with your PC are better options than updating over your carrier's cell network.
